Due to the great damage caused by the Muroto-typhoon in 1924, technical standards for large-scale wooden construction needed to be revised. We have found that school auditorium buildings still exist in Tokai district built in early Showa-period before the WWII and they are good materials to analyze the technical transition at the time. This paper describes about the historically noteworthy aspects of the buildings based on the field survey, construction drawings and interviews as well as structural analysis about the wooden truss to enable a large space. We hope this study contributes to the evaluation and conservation of cultural properties.
